Left it at home so I could have a look at it tonight without been burned.

Think my oil feed to the turbo is weeping oil slightly :sad: New pipe time I guess...

Tried to remove the gear lever gaiter to see if I could see the gear lever cable ends inside the car but could not figure out how to get the gaitor out. Ive done it before too  :embarrassed:

Gear linkage cable in engine bay seems missing a dust cover  :undecided: this would explain why its going notchy.
Maybe time to S3 short shift it at the same time as greasing the cable end and linkage?

The lower part of the gear lever gaitor just unclips from within the brushed chrome surround.  There's about 4 moulded plastic tabs that hold it in place and if you gently push down all around the edges it should spring free.  I only know because mine constantly comes unhooked and is a pain.    Not sure about removing the upper part that goes into the gear knob.
